Your Ultimate Guide to Thai Foot Massage and Reflexology: Discover Benefits and Techniques

The art of Thai Foot Massage and Reflexology has been practised for centuries, passed down through generations as an integral component of traditional Thai healing practices. This unique form of massage therapy combines elements of acupressure, Ayurveda, and Chinese reflexology to rejuvenate the body, mind, and spirit. 

Thai Foot Massage and Reflexology offer a holistic approach to wellness, promoting balance and harmony throughout the body’s systems. This specialised therapy focuses on the feet, as they are believed to correspond to various organs and body parts through reflex points, which are energy channels connected to the body’s vital energy, known as “Prana” or “Qi.” By working on these reflex points, Thai foot massage and reflexology can aid in releasing blocked energy, improve circulation, and stimulate the body’s self-healing abilities.

Unique Techniques of Thai Foot Massage and Reflexology

1. Foot Soak and Scrub

A Thai Foot Massage session typically begins with a relaxing foot soak and scrub that helps cleanse, soften, and prepare your feet for the massage. The warm water and natural ingredients like Epsom salts, essential oils, and botanical extracts help soothe tired and achy feet, setting the stage for a rejuvenating experience.

2. Thai Wooden Stick

One of the unique tools used in Thai Foot Massage is the wooden stick, specifically designed to stimulate reflex points on the feet with precision. Using a combination of pressure and rubbing movements, the therapist addresses various reflex points in a structured sequence to enhance circulation, release blockages, and promote relaxation.

3. Foot and Leg Massage

In addition to working with the wooden stick, Thai Foot Massage also incorporates several massage techniques for the feet and lower legs. Therapists use their hands and fingers to apply pressure, knead, and stretch the muscles and soft tissues, which further assists in relieving tension and improving circulation.

4. Thai Stretches and Mobilisation

Thai Foot Massage often includes gentle stretches and mobilisation exercises for the feet, ankles, and lower legs. These movements help improve flexibility, restore joint mobility, and release any stiffness or restrictions held in the lower extremities.

Benefits of Thai Foot Massage and Reflexology

1. Improved Circulation

By stimulating reflex points and utilising massage techniques, Thai Foot Massage encourages blood flow, providing vital nutrients and oxygen to the muscles and tissues. Improved circulation can lead to enhanced healing, reduced muscle soreness, and increased energy levels.

2. Stress Reduction and Relaxation

One of the fundamental principles of Thai Foot Massage is to create a deep sense of relaxation and balance within the body. By targeting reflex points and utilising soothing massage techniques, this therapy helps reduce stress, calm the nervous system, and promote a feeling of peace and tranquillity.

3. Pain Relief

Thai Foot Massage can provide relief from various aches and pains, particularly in the feet and lower legs. By stimulating reflex points and using targeted massage techniques, therapists can alleviate discomfort from conditions such as plantar fasciitis, shin splints, and general foot and ankle soreness.

4. Immune System Support

According to the principles of reflexology, stimulating specific points on the feet can correspond to different organs and systems within the body, including the immune system. By promoting balance and optimising the body’s energy flow, Thai Foot Massage can contribute to overall immune system support and improved well-being.
